Government Shutdown Freezes Vaccine Cases

As of December 22, 2018, the appropriations act funding the Department of Justice (“DOJ”) expired and appropriations for DOJ lapsed. Absent an appropriation, DOJ employees are prohibited from working, except in very limited circumstances.

Accordingly, all deadlines for Respondent in cases pending before the Office of Special Masters, absent a subsequent Order of the assigned Special Master, are hereby STAYED until DOJ appropriations are restored.
